基于热力学方法的给水泵性能曲线计算

摘    要:根据现场采集的汽动给水泵运行数据,利用ISO5198中提出的热力学方法计算得出了给水泵的各项运行性能参数,又通过最小二乘法回归分析得到运行中锅炉给水泵的性能曲线.这些曲线不仅为给水泵运行性能考核提供依据,也为整个机组经济性的分析提供了依据.并通过实例证明了该方法用于电厂运行条件下的试验,可操作性强,简单方便,同时经过误差分析,试验结果以及计算结果满足要求,证明了此计算方法是确实可行的.

关 键 词:热力学方法  最小二乘法回归分析  性能曲线

Calculation of Characteristic Curves of Feed Water Pump Based upon Thermodynamics Method

Abstract:According to the gathered operation data of feed water pump driven by steam turbine, the characteristic parameters of feed water pump was thesis calculated by the thermodynamics method theorem inferred by ISO5198, and the characteristic curves was got by the least squared method regression analysis. These characteristic curves offer the bases of the feed water pump performance estimation and the whole unit economical analysis. And the testing result and the calculating result are able to satisfy the required accuracy by error analysis, the calculation is proved to be available.
Keywords:thermodynamics method  least squared method regression analysis  characteristic curves
